"We spent three years listening. Over a hundred people in 25 countries told us their real pivot stories- not the LinkedIn version. The messy, terrifying, honest version. We also talked to experts such as psychologists, behavioral scientists, financial planners, AI experts, personal branding specialists, and we built a framework. Not theory. Not 'follow your passion.' A practical, four-phase process: Discover, Define, Shape, Test." - Luis R. Baptista and Juliana N. Pereira

The world of work is evolving at unprecedented speed. AI, automation, and shifting industries are redefining career stability, leaving many professionals uncertain about what comes next.

Pivot-Quest is a practical, research-backed guide to navigating career change with clarity and confidence.

Drawing from their own multiple international career pivots and extensive research with successful career pivoters, Luis R. Baptista and Juliana N. Pereira present a structured, step-by-step framework for reinvention. This is not theory or motivation alone. It is a clear blueprint designed to reduce risk, manage uncertainty, and help you move forward strategically.

Inside, you will learn how to assess your current position, identify transferable strengths, design a transition plan aligned with future workforce demands, and build momentum without burning out.

If you are actively seeking change or preparing for disruption, Pivot-Quest offers a proven path to reset your career with purpose and direction.

Luis knows what it feels like to wonder if you chose wrong. Over seven career transitions across three continents, he went from civil engineer to running a $300M retail operation to teaching at one of Europe's top business schools. He also launched three start-ups along the way. Some of those moves were brave. Some were terrifying. Not all of them worked out the way he planned.He holds an MBA from Kellogg and teaches at IE University. His Coursera course on "brand" and "product strategy" has reached over 150,000 professionals worldwide. But the real insights came from spending three years listening to over 100 people in 25 countries tell the honest version of their career-pivot stories, the version they don't put on LinkedIn. Luis writes for anyone navigating career change without a map, whether you're quietly questioning or suddenly forced to start over.
